Every now and then I'll accidentally drag and drop a vm on another one. What Virtualbox does in this case is group them together. This, however, results in the actual vm folders getting moved to a new folder with the group name. My problem is that a lot of times, VMs may be running and file locks prevent a complete move to the new folder. I've noticed that when I stop the VMs, the original folder is completely deleted, so I am losing my state/corrupting the VMs. Is there a way to stop Virtualbox from automatically moving the VM folder when adding machines to a group?
